Adjectives and adverbs See all 165 skills Web15 phonics rules for reading and spelling By Ginny Osewalt When kids and adults learn to read, they’re connecting how words sound to how those sounds are represented by letters. Phonics instruction helps make those connections. Phonics instruction also teaches spelling patterns and spelling rules. It teaches about parts of words called syllables.
